Mercedes-AMG launches limited edition of the A 45 S 4Matic+.

Mercedes-AMG presented the limited edition of the A45 S 4Matic+, a model that comes in the color Green Hell Magno, which until now was only available for the top-of-the-range models of the Mercedes sports division.

Thus, the limited edition of the AMG A45 S 4Matic+ presents itself with a green exterior paint with yellow details and black stripes on the bodywork, as well as the inscription “AQ45S” on the doors and the AMG emblem on the hood.

Also noteworthy are the 19” forged wheels in matte black with yellow spokes, and the braking system with glossy black brake calipers with white AMG lettering.

Other refined details of this limited edition version include a fuel cap with the Affalterbach brand logo, and rearview mirrors that project the AMG emblem on the ground whenever the doors open, as well as illuminated door sills.

In the interior, the highlight is the AMG Performance sports seats, which are upholstered in black with a combination of Artico synthetic leather and Microcut microfiber, with yellow stitching on both the seats and door panels, as well as on the instrument panel. In addition, the headrests feature a yellow “45 S” embroidery.

This special edition of the AMG A45 S 4Matic+ comes standard with the AMG Night Package, Night Package II, and AMG Aerodynamics packages. The latter includes a fixed rear wing and other elements that have been optimized in the wind tunnel.

As for the engine, the new AMG model is equipped with the well-known 2.0-liter turbocharged four-cylinder engine with 421 hp and 500 Nm of maximum torque, which is paired with an eight-speed automatic transmission and powers the variable AMG Performance 4Matic+ all-wheel drive system. This allows the car to accelerate from 0 to 100 km/h in 3.9 seconds and reach a limited top speed of 270 km/h.

AMG has already announced that this new special edition will be available only between April and the end of 2024.
